\"RockyThere are generally two academic credentials available that provide education to become an LPN near Rocky Point NY<\/strong>. The one that may be completed in the shortest time frame, usually about 12 months, is the certificate or diploma program. The other choice is to obtain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are broader in nature than the diploma alternative and usually require 2 years to complete. The benefit of Associate Degrees, in addition to offering a higher credential and more comprehensive instruction,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. No matter the kind of credential you seek, it should be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or any other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C attests that the core curriculum properly pr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that the majority of gra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.<\/p>\n

What is an LPN?<\/h3>\n

\"RockyLicensed Practical Nurses have a number of functions that they carry out in the Rocky Point NY healthcare facilities where they are employed. As their titles imply, they are mandated to be licensed in all states, including New York. Although they may be accountable for managing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ves typically work under the direction of either an RN or a doctor. The health care facilities where they work are numerous and varied, for example h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anywhere that you can find patients requiring medical care is their dominion. Each state not only controls their licensing, but also what functions an LPN can and can’t perform.
